She’s best known for being part of TV’s ultimate girl gang as one of the presenters on Loose Women, but while the hit show has been temporaril­y cancelled amid the coronaviru­s crisis, Saira Khan insists all of the hosts – including Andrea McLean, Nadia Sawalha, Stacey Solomon and Janet Street-Porter – are just as close off screen.

Saira, 49, says, “We have a WhatsApp group, and we have a laugh – but also we ask for advice and we all know what’s going on in each other’s lives. It’s hard to explain, because it’s not the kind of friendship

I’ve ever experience­d before. It’s so open – we talk about things that it might take somebody years to talk about. I go, ‘Oh Nads, I sneezed the other day and I weed my pants’, and she goes, ‘I’ve got a cure for that!’ We don’t feel embarrasse­d because we’ve known each other for so long.”

Recently, the magazine-style panel show hit the headlines when actress and panellist Linda Robson talked about her battle with alcoholism and anxiety, revealing she’d had a two-month stay in rehab as a result.

And Saira, who’s so proud of her friend, says it’s the supportive nature of the show that enabled her to open up.

She says, “It was so brave of Linda. Behind the scenes, we know what she’s been going through. It’s not easy, when you get older, to say, ‘I’m not okay, things are catching up with me’. I think the fact she did it on Loose Women shows what a supportive environmen­t it is.

“There are no other women on a TV show who come out there and just say, ‘This is what’s going on in my life’. And that’s why, when the National Television Awards come around and we don’t win, we go, ‘Oh please!’ It’s because we’re so passionate.”

Saira first rose to fame in 2005 when she was runner-up on The Apprentice, and then went on to star on Celebrity Big Brother and Dancing On Ice. She’s been married to husband Steve – with whom she shares son Zachariah, 11, and daughter Amara, eight – for 16 years. While he stays out of the public eye, Saira often talks about him while discussing issues on the show.

She’s even talked about their sex life on air, revealing last year she’d lost her libido during the menopause. She’s also previously chatted about times when things were good “in the bedroom department”.

She previously said, “It’s Steve’s laid-back nature that drew us together.” She adds she’s grateful he doesn’t mind her loose lips; she once revealed she’d said he could sleep with another woman as she’d lost her sex drive.

She says, “I need someone like my husband Steve as a partner. When I go home, I’m like, ‘Steve, I’ve just told the whole world about our sex life, I’m really sorry.’ And he doesn’t go mental – he just goes, ‘Okay, why did you have to do that?’ He’s just level-headed. We balance each other out.

“He married me because I’m the total opposite of him. If you met Steve, you’d be like, ‘Why are these two together?’ He’s so calm and measured and chilled out. Opposites really do attract.”

Saira’s one of the most honest, upfront and open stars of Loose Women, never afraid to hold back or voice her opinion. And last year, she revealed even more of herself when she stripped down for a photo shoot – as well as

posing in just her underwear with the other panellists, for an empowering campaign about body confidence the year before.

Last week, Saira revealed she’d lost weight and toned up after seven weeks of gym training, showing on Instagram how she could now fit into a pair of jeans that, before, she hadn’t been able to get past her thighs.

And as she gears up for her milestone birthday of 50 later this year, Saira says she’s never felt more body confident, revealing, “I’ve done a few ‘nudies’ and I tell you what, they were so bloody empowering. I was nervous, I was scared, but it felt so great.

“I used to worry about my body. But to do a ‘nudie’, it felt amazing and I loved it. I think every woman should do one for the confidence you get afterwards.

“And it’s my fiftieth this year! It’s a big milestone for women nowadays. It’s a great time in your life. I’ll do another nudie in a few years, in my mid-fifties – 100 per cent!”
